Output ab17523193bdf3bfdc46c418b9275e6fba1e74c2c2624086431f3a726f28a786:3

value
136885
script pubkey
OP_0 OP_PUSHBYTES_20 3a7aa487456877de38b5f7ea0b0ab39902f5c821
address
bc1q8fa2fp69dpmauw947l4qkz4nnyp0tjppcgu7qn
transaction
ab17523193bdf3bfdc46c418b9275e6fba1e74c2c2624086431f3a726f28a786
spent
true